Masimo Names Michelle Brennan as Interim Chief Executive; Reiterates Q3 Guidance
Oct 3, 2024 1:23 AM

09:42 AM EDT, 09/25/2024 (MT Newswires) -- Masimo ( MASI ) said Wednesday that Michelle Brennan has been named as interim chief executive, replacing Joe Kiani, who has resigned.

Brennan, who joined Masimo's ( MASI ) board in 2023, previously served as a senior executive at Johnson & Johnson (JNJ), Masimo ( MASI ) said

Additionally, Masimo ( MASI ) reiterated its Q3 non-GAAP earnings guidance of $0.81 to $0.86 per diluted share on revenue of $495 million to $515 million.

Analysts polled by Capital IQ expect adjusted EPS $0.84 on revenue of $502.5 million.

Masimo ( MASI ) shares were more than 5% higher in recent trading.
